PC Res 2180PLANNING COMMISSION
CITY OF CAMPBELL, CALIFORNIA
RESOLUTION N0. 2180
After notification and public hearing as specified by law on the application
of Mr. Cosimo Giancola fora use permit and approval of plans to allow the
construction of a sin le family dwelling on property known as 1223 Harriet
Avenue in an Interim Low Density Residential) Zoning District, as per the
application filed in the Office of the Planning Department on March 4, 1983
and after presentation by the Planning Director, proponents and opponents,
the hearing was closed (UP 83-01).
After due consideration of all the evidence presented, the Commission did
find as follows:
That the establishment, maintenance, and operation of the
proposed use will not be detrimental to the health, safety,
peace, morals, comfort or general welfare of the persons
residing or working in the neighborhood of such use, or
be detrimental or injurious to property and improvements in
the neighborhood or the general welfare of the City.
Based on the above findings, the Planning Commission does hereby grant the
requested use permit subject to conditions listed in the attached Exhibit A.
The applicant is notified as part of this application that he is required to
comply with all applicable Codes or Ordinances of the City of Campbell and
the State of California which pertain to this development and are not herein
specified.
